WP(C) Nos.6676/2015 and WP(C) Nos.6685/2015], a separate show cause notice was issued by the Principal Commissioner of Income Tax, Guwahati-1 and the said notice is extracted here-in-below for ready reference: .. Sub: Centralisation of Search Seisure cases Sir, 1. Your case is proposed to be transferred u/s. 127 of the Income-tax Act,1961 from the ACIT, Circle-2, Guwahati to the O/o. Assistant/Deputy Commissioner of Income-tax, Central Circle-28, New Delhi. 2. Opportunity of being heard is hereby granted to furnish your comments on or before 30/07/2015. In case your comments are not received by 30/07/2015, it shall be presumed that you have no objection to transfer your case to the office of the Assistant/Deputy Commissioner of Income-tax, Central Circle-28, New Delhi. Yours faithfully, Income Tax Officer (Tech.) For, Principal Commissioner of Income Tax, Guwahati-I, Guwahati 5. As can be seen from the above notice(s), the transfer was proposed for centralization of the cases of different assessees, under one Officer of the Income Tax Department and that is why the assessees were asked to respond as to why, thei .....

..... have highlighted the absence of reason in the show cause notice and requested intimation of the reason, for facilitating effective representation in the proceeding under Sub-Section (2) of Section 127 of the Income Tax Act. Therefore the decision in Rathi and Co. (Supra) should not detain us in the present cases. 14. When a notice under Section 127 of the Income Tax Act is issued, it must prima facie show due application of mind and reasons must also be disclosed so that an effective opportunity is provided to the affected party to respond to the show cause notice. The contemplated hearing in such matter to the assessee must be effective and not a mere formality. Bare omnibus statement that the transfer is intended for the purpose of centralization of cases will not be enough since all the cases can be centralized under an officer based in Guwahati and transfer of jurisdiction to an officer at New Delhi would not be justified for the reason disclosed, more so, in view of Sub-section (9A) of Section 132 of the Income Tax Act. 15.
